Abstract
BackgroundAngiotensin II (Ang II) induces oxidative stress and apoptosis in vascular endothelial cells. We hypothesized that propofol may attenuate Ang II-induced apoptosis in human coronary artery endothelial cells (HCAECs) and aimed to identify the underlying mechanisms.MethodsEndothelial cells were pre-treated with propofol and then stimulated with Ang II.
